Description
Atos Unify OpenScape Session Border Controller through V10 R3.01.03 allows execution of administrative scripts by unauthenticated users.
Comprehensive Technical Analysis of CVE-2023-36619
1. Vulnerability Assessment and Severity Evaluation
CVE ID: CVE-2023-36619 Description: Atos Unify OpenScape Session Border Controller through V10 R3.01.03 allows execution of administrative scripts by unauthenticated users. CVSS Score: 9.8
The CVSS score of 9.8 indicates a critical vulnerability. This high score is due to the potential for unauthenticated users to execute administrative scripts, which can lead to full system compromise. The severity is amplified by the lack of authentication requirements, making it easier for attackers to exploit the vulnerability.

3. Affected Systems and Software Versions
Affected Systems:
- Atos Unify OpenScape Session Border Controller
Software Versions:
- All versions through V10 R3.01.03
Organizations using these versions of the Atos Unify OpenScape Session Border Controller are at risk and should prioritize patching or implementing mitigation strategies.

6. Technical Details for Security Professionals
Vulnerability Details:
- Type: Authentication Bypass leading to Remote Code Execution (RCE)
- Impact: Full system compromise, including the ability to execute administrative scripts and commands.
Exploit Availability:
- Exploits for this vulnerability are publicly available, as indicated by references to Packet Storm Security and SEC Consult.
